Crossway Baptist Church is a Baptist Christian church in Burwood East, Victoria, Australia.

[edit] History

Mr C.E. Burden of the Bush Sunday School Union of Victoria visited Burwood in November 1949 and at his invitation Mr R.W. Jones established a Sunday School which met at the Blackburn South Primary School.

In 1952 an approach was made to the Victorian Baptist Home Missionary Society and consequently a hall was erected on the corner of Cantebury and Hollands Roads on two blocks of land which had been purchased by the Society in August 1950. The new hall was opened on 24 April 1954 and at the Fellowship's first business meeting in June 1954 the Blackburn Baptist Church was officially consitituted.

In 1957 Rev George Ashworth became the Church's first full time pastor. In 1962 the Church was relocated to Holland Road to allow for continued growth. Rev David Griffiths was the pastor from 1963 to 1972, followed by Rev Rowland Croucher from 1973 to 1981.

Rev Dr Stuart Robinson became the Senior Pastor in February 1983. The church purchased land on the corner of Springvale Road and Vision Drive in 1990 and the Church relocated there in 1995. In February 1996 the Church's name was changed to Crossway in order to reflect the congregation's regional nature as well as its vision and values.

Crossway Baptist is one of Melbourne's largest and most well-known churches, with 3300 members as of 2004.
